Mocha Frappe Recipe at Home
If you’re craving a deliciously indulgent treat that’s perfect for warm days or any time you need a pick-me-up, a Mocha Frappe is just the thing! This delightful blend of coffee, chocolate, and creamy goodness will quickly become your go-to refreshment.
Quick Facts
- Time: 10 minutes
- Yield: 2 servings
- Brew method: Blender
Ingredients
- 1 cup brewed coffee, cooled
- 1 cup milk (dairy or non-dairy)
- 2 tablespoons chocolate syrup
- 2 tablespoons sugar (adjust to taste)
- 2 cups ice
- Whipped cream for topping
- Chocolate shavings or cocoa powder for garnish (optional)
Equipment
- Blender
- Measuring cups and spoons
- Serving glasses
Method
- Start by brewing your favorite coffee and let it cool to room temperature, about 10-15 minutes.
- In your blender, combine the cooled coffee, milk, chocolate syrup, sugar, and ice.
- Blend on high until you achieve a smooth, creamy consistency, about 30-45 seconds.
- Taste your Mocha Frappe and adjust the sweetness if needed by adding more sugar or chocolate syrup.
- Pour the mixture into serving glasses and top with whipped cream.
- If you’re feeling fancy, sprinkle some chocolate shavings or cocoa powder on top before serving.
Variations
- For a sweeter treat, add more chocolate syrup or a drizzle on top.
- Use almond, oat, or coconut milk for a non-dairy version.
- Swap the ice for hot coffee if you’re in the mood for a warm treat!
Troubleshooting
- If your Frappe is too thick, add a splash more milk to reach your desired consistency.
